Frequently Asked Questions

What is the KSA Low Cost Carrier Market?

The KSA Low Cost Carrier Market refers to airlines operating in Saudi Arabia that offer lower fares by eliminating traditional passenger services. This market has seen significant growth due to rising demand for affordable travel options and government initiatives to boost air travel.


What are the key growth drivers in the KSA Low Cost Carrier Market?

Key growth drivers include increasing demand for affordable travel, expansion of domestic tourism, government initiatives to promote air travel, and rising disposable incomes among the population, making air travel more accessible to a broader audience.


What challenges do low-cost carriers face in Saudi Arabia?

Low-cost carriers in Saudi Arabia face challenges such as intense competition among airlines, regulatory hurdles and compliance costs, fluctuating fuel prices, and customer perceptions regarding service quality, which can impact their market position and profitability.


What opportunities exist for low-cost carriers in the KSA market?

Opportunities for low-cost carriers include the development of new routes, partnerships with travel agencies, introduction of ancillary services, and leveraging technology for operational efficiency, which can enhance customer experience and increase revenue streams.


How has the KSA Low Cost Carrier Market evolved over time?

The KSA Low Cost Carrier Market has evolved through regulatory changes, increased competition, and a growing consumer base seeking affordable travel options. The market has adapted to changing consumer preferences and technological advancements, leading to a more dynamic airline landscape.
